I think you're confusing Dropbox the application and service with a drop box, which is a generic directory/folder that has permissions so that it can be used as a drop box.
That choice, "Write Only (Drop Box)" is available throughout Mac OS even if you never installed Dropbox the application. It's not an "unneeded option," it's part of the system and you should just ignore it.
